14k Gold Jewelry Care Guide
Maintain your jewelry’s radiance and value with this essential care routine.
- Soak & Prep: Mix mild dish soap with warm water. Soak jewelry for 15–20 minutes to loosen oils and debris.
- Clean & Rinse: Gently scrub with a soft-bristled toothbrush. Rinse under lukewarm water (ensure the drain is closed).
- Dry & Polish: Pat dry with a microfiber towel and buff gently to restore natural luster.
Gemstone Safety
- Pearls, Opals, & Turquoise: Do not soak. Wipe with a damp cloth only.
- Diamonds: Safe to soak, but ensure settings are secure.
Pro Maintenance
- Storage: Keep in a soft pouch to prevent scratches.
- Avoid: Remove jewelry before swimming, exercising, or using chemicals.
- Inspection: Have a jeweler check your pieces annually.
